pub struct GPXProperties {
pub name: Option<String>,
pub cmt: Option<String>,
pub desc: Option<String>,
pub src: Option<String>,
pub link: Option<Vec<GPXLink>>,
pub number: Option<usize>,
pub route_type: Option<String>,
pub track_type: Option<String>,
}Expand description
Represents a route, which is an ordered list of waypoints leading to a destination.
Fields§
§name: Option<String>Route name
cmt: Option<String>Route comment
desc: Option<String>Route description
src: Option<String>Source of data
link: Option<Vec<GPXLink>>Links to external information
number: Option<usize>Route number
route_type: Option<String>Classification type of the route
track_type: Option<String>Classification type of the track
